How to get from Mesta, Chios to Mykonos
Getting from Mesta, Chios to Mykonos is most efficiently done by ferry. The closest ferry terminal is located in Chios Town, about 25 kilometers north of Mesta. From Mesta, you can take a bus or a taxi, with buses typically running every hour and taking around 30 minutes. Taxis provide a faster but slightly pricier option, making the journey in about 20 minutes.
Upon arrival at Chios ferry terminal, you will find a bustling port area where vessels to Mykonos depart. The waiting area is usually marked clearly, but it's advisable to keep an eye on tickets or display boards for any changes. Arriving early can help you navigate the boarding process and find a good spot on the ferry.

Can I bring my pet on board?
Yes, pets are allowed on ferries from Mesta, Chios to Mykonos, but specific policies vary by ferry company. General guidelines:
- Pets over 10 kg must be kept in the ship’s onboard kennels; pets under 10 kg can stay in their owner’s pet carrier.
- Service dogs are exempt from kennel requirements.
- Ensure you have all the necessary documents, tickets, and pet essentials for your trip.
- Greek operators typically allow pets for free.

Exploring Mykonos
Mykonos is a beautiful Greek island that everyone should explore! It’s famous for its stunning beaches, like Elia and Paradise, where you can swim, sunbathe, and have fun with friends. The colorful little streets of Mykonos Town are filled with cute shops, delicious restaurants, and lively nightlife. Be sure to try the local food, especially fresh seafood and yummy pastries!
One of the coolest places to visit is the iconic windmills overlooking the sea. You can also see the charming Church of Panagia Paraportiani, which has white walls that shine in the sunlight. For some adventure, rent a bike or take a boat ride to nearby Delos Island. It’s an ancient place full of ruins and history, perfect for exploring.
If you’re looking for hidden gems, check out Agios Sostis Beach for a quieter spot or visit the cute village of Ano Mera, where you can find a lovely monastery and traditional taverns.
